Heart Rings

Heart rings have always been a classical sign of love and devotion between two people. Even if this love is nothing more than puppy love the first gift the boy gives his girl is a toy heart ring. They are not only given as tokens of love between couples but they are also used as tokens of friendship.

There is a classical model which has always been a favorite of many, it is the half heart ring. The set includes two rings and each ring has half of the heart. The heart is not cut straight down the middle but it is a jagged cut and when put together the two pieces fit exactly to complete the heart. What this means is that the heart is not complete and happy when the parts are separated. It also says that when they are separated each one has half of a heart that beats as one for both of them.

Heart rings are designed in many shapes and sizes. They are made of gold, silver and many other metals, you can even find them in plastic for children to give away. Young girls love to exchange them with their closest friends and buddies.  Whatever the material it is made of or the amount of money spent to buy it; it is a token of love and friendship that has been used forever.
